There’s a brawl going on in the photography world, and this Denver exhibit gives you a ringside seat

The Know | 03/31/2019

Davenport presents an alternative universe in a solo show at Leon Gallery in the Uptown neighborhood.

Photo by Jeff Davenport

Read More